Understanding Your Vehicle’s Electrical System
Every car has a complex network that keeps it running smoothly. Think of the battery as the heart of your car. It provides the initial surge of power to get everything moving. Without a strong heart, your vehicle just won’t wake up in the morning. It is the foundation for every other component in the system.
The alternator acts as the lifeline for continuous power generation. While the engine runs, the alternator creates electricity to keep the battery charged. It also sends juice to your radio, lights, and air conditioning. If the alternator fails, your battery will quickly run out of steam. This cycle is vital for keeping your car on the road safely.
Wiring and fuses act like the veins and nerves of your vehicle. Fuses protect your expensive electronics from getting too much power at once. If a surge happens, the fuse blows to save the component. Wiring carries that power to every corner of your car. Keeping this network healthy prevents dangerous short circuits and fires.
Modern vehicles rely heavily on sensors and Electronic Control Units. These are the brains that monitor fuel, air, and exhaust. They talk to each other constantly to optimize your driving experience. When one sensor fails, it can cause a chain reaction of glitches. Understanding this digital side is key to modern vehicle maintenance.
Dead or Weak Battery Issues

A dead battery is one of the most common car electrical problems drivers face. It usually happens at the worst possible time, like when you are late for work. Knowing the early signs can save you from being stranded. Most batteries will give you a few hints before they give up completely.
Identifying a Failing Battery
- Dimming interior lights are a classic sign that your battery is losing its punch.
- Engine cranking slowly means the battery is struggling to provide enough amperage to the starter.
- Battery warning light on your dashboard is a direct message from your car that something is wrong.
- Car stalling shortly after you start it can indicate the battery cannot hold a charge.
Causes of Battery Drainage
Most car batteries only last about four to six years under normal conditions. Extreme heat or freezing temperatures can significantly shorten this lifespan. Leaving your interior lights or radio on overnight is a fast way to drain the juice. Sometimes, a faulty charging system component like the alternator is actually to blame.
Maintenance and Prevention Tips
- Regular long-distance drives are important because they allow the alternator to fully recharge the battery.
- Cleaning terminals removes corrosion and acid buildup that blocks the flow of electricity.
- Hardware security is vital because vibrations can shake the internal plates of the battery and cause failure.
- Avoiding extreme heat whenever possible will help your battery live a much longer life.
Replacement Costs and Expectations
The average cost to replace a car battery is between $400 and $430. This price includes about $60 to $80 for labor at a professional shop. High-quality parts usually run between $340 and $350. Make sure you choose a battery with the right Cold Cranking Amps for your local weather.
Faulty Alternator and Charging System
If the battery is the heart, the alternator is the muscle that keeps things moving. It is responsible for recharging the battery while you are cruising down the highway. When it starts to fail, your car will rely solely on the battery. This will only last a short time before the whole car shuts down.
Warning Signs of Alternator Failure
- Power warning lights like the “ALT” or battery symbol may flicker on your dash.
- Fluctuating electricity can cause your headlights to get very bright and then suddenly dim.
- Loss of power to gadgets like your GPS or power windows is a common red flag.
- Grinding noises from the engine bay often mean the internal bearings are wearing out.
- Burned rubber smell might indicate that the drive belt is slipping or the alternator is overheating.
Root Causes of Alternator Malfunction

Internal wear and tear on brushes and diodes eventually happens to every alternator. Damaged bearings can cause a lot of friction and noise before the unit seizes. A snapped or worn drive belt will stop the alternator from spinning entirely. Dust and heat are also major enemies of this complex electrical component.
Proactive Care for Your Alternator
- Immediate repairs are necessary because a bad alternator will quickly ruin a perfectly good battery.
- Serpentine belt inspection should be part of every oil change to look for cracks or fraying.
- Avoiding upgrades like massive subwoofers can prevent you from overloading the factory electrical system.
- Professional inspection is recommended if you notice any changes in how your electronics perform.
Blown Fuses and Fuse Box Complications
Fuses are the unsung heroes of your car’s electrical health. They are designed to break the circuit if too much electricity flows through. This prevents your expensive sensors or radio from melting or catching fire. A blown fuse is usually a symptom of a larger problem somewhere else.

Recognizing Fuse-Related Issues
- Specific features like the horn or just one power window might suddenly stop working.
- Visual inspection of a fuse will show a broken metal strip or a dark, burnt appearance.
- Repeated failures of the same fuse mean you have a short circuit that needs a pro.
Signs of a Failing Fuse Box
Sometimes the problem is not the fuse itself but the box it sits in. You might notice fuses fitting loosely in their slots, which causes a bad connection. Melted plastic around the fuse slots is a sign of extreme heat and a fire risk. Evidence of water stains or corrosion means moisture is getting where it should not be.
Troubleshooting and Repair
- DIY replacement is very easy and usually costs less than $10 for a pack of fuses.
- Color-coded amperage must be followed exactly to ensure you do not cause a fire.
- Professional diagnosis is needed if fuses keep blowing immediately after you replace them.
- Manual reference is the best way to find out which fuse controls which part of your car.
Faulty Starter Motor and Ignition System
The starter motor has one job: to spin the engine fast enough to start. It takes a massive amount of power from the battery to do this. If the starter fails, you are not going anywhere without a tow truck. It is one of the most critical parts of your vehicle’s ignition system.
Symptoms of Starter Failure
- Rapid clicking when you turn the key usually means the solenoid is trying but failing to engage.
- Intermittent starting is a sign the internal components are on their last legs.
- Smoke or smells during a start attempt mean the motor is drawing too much current and burning.
- Complete silence when you turn the key could mean the starter is totally dead.
Primary Causes of Starter Wear
Worn solenoids and corroded electrical connections are the most common culprits. Engine oil leaks can drip onto the starter and gum up the internal parts. Excessive stop-start driving, like in heavy city traffic, wears out the motor faster. Sometimes the teeth on the starter gear simply wear down and cannot grab the engine.
Maintaining Starter Health
- Corrosion control on your battery terminals prevents high resistance that damages the starter motor.
- Early detection of clicking sounds can save you from being stranded in a parking lot.
- Fixing oil leaks promptly will protect the starter from being soaked in damaging fluids.
- Checking connections to make sure the thick power wires are tight and clean is very helpful.
Spark Plugs and Ignition Coil Malfunctions

Spark plugs and coils provide the fire that makes your engine run. They must fire at the exact right microsecond for the engine to work correctly. If they are dirty or broken, your car will run like garbage. This is a core part of car electrical problems that affect performance.
Indicators of Ignition Trouble
- Engine misfiring feels like a sudden jerk or stumble while you are driving or idling.
- Rough idling makes the whole car shake while you are stopped at a red light.
- Check engine light will often flash if you have a serious misfire that can damage the engine.
- Drop in fuel economy happens because the engine is not burning gas efficiently anymore.
Factors Leading to Failure
Carbon buildup happens naturally over time and makes it hard for the spark to jump. Exposure to moisture or oil leaks in the spark plug wells will kill a coil fast. Heat damage to the insulation on the ignition coils causes the power to leak out. Using the wrong type of spark plug can also lead to poor engine performance.
Replacement and Longevity
- Manufacturer schedule should be followed strictly for replacing your spark plugs on time.
- OEM parts are usually better than cheap generic ones for sensitive ignition systems.
- Replacing cables along with plugs ensures that the power has a clean path to travel.
- Diagnostic tools can help a mechanic see exactly which cylinder is having a problem.
Complex Wiring and Connector Problems

Your car has miles of wiring hidden behind the dash and under the floor. These wires carry data and power to every single sensor and light. When wiring goes bad, it can cause the weirdest glitches you have ever seen. Troubleshooting these car electrical problems often requires a lot of patience.
Signs of Damaged Car Wiring
- Unpredictable glitches like your radio turning off when you hit the brakes are common.
- Burning plastic odors are a serious warning that a wire is melting somewhere.
- Flickering lights can mean a wire is loose or rubbing against a metal part of the car.
- Ghosting gauges might show your speed or fuel level jumping around for no reason.
Environmental and Physical Causes
Rodents love to chew on car wiring because the insulation is often made of soy. Road salt and moisture can cause corrosion to crawl inside the wires and rot them. Constant engine vibration can cause wires to rub together until they fray. Heat cycles from the engine can make wire insulation brittle and cause it to crack.
The Cost of Rewiring
Tracing a short circuit can take hours of labor, which gets very expensive quickly. Full-vehicle rewiring is a massive job that can cost between $1,200 and $1,500. Specialized diagnostic tools are needed to find exactly where a wire is broken. Preventing rodent damage by using deterrents is much cheaper than fixing chewed wires.
Malfunctioning Vehicle Sensors
Modern cars use dozens of sensors to monitor every breath the engine takes. These sensors send data to the computer to keep things running perfectly. If a sensor sends the wrong data, the computer will get confused. This usually leads to poor performance and warning lights.
Critical Sensors and Their Roles
- Oxygen sensors measure the exhaust to help the engine use the right amount of gas.
- TPMS sensors live inside your tires and tell you when the pressure is too low.
- Knock sensors listen for pings in the engine to prevent internal damage.
- Mass Airflow sensors tell the computer exactly how much air is entering the engine.
Symptoms of Sensor Failure
A failing sensor can put your car into “limp mode” to protect the engine. You might notice poor idling or your car stalling unexpectedly at stop signs. Your gas mileage will likely tank, and you might fail your local emissions test. Often, the car will feel sluggish and won’t accelerate like it used to.
Prevention and Replacement
- Cleaning air filters regularly keeps dirt from coating and killing sensitive sensors.
- High-quality sensors are vital because cheap ones often give inaccurate readings.
- Inspecting connectors for corrosion can solve many sensor problems without needing a new part.
- Prompt attention to dashboard lights prevents a small sensor issue from ruining your catalytic converter.
Automotive Lighting System Failures
Your lights are not just for you to see; they are so others can see you. Working headlights and brake lights are required by law in every state. Lighting issues are usually simple, but they can sometimes be tricky. This is a safety-first part of car electrical problems.
Visibility and Safety Indicators
- Total failure of one or both headlights is a major safety hazard at night.
- Rapid-blinking signals usually mean one of your turn signal bulbs has burnt out.
- Dim or yellowed output happens as bulbs age or if the plastic lenses get cloudy.
- Brake light failure is dangerous because drivers behind you won’t know when you are stopping.
Diagnosing Light Issues
Most lighting problems are just a simple burnt-out bulb that you can swap yourself. If a new bulb does not work, you might have a faulty switch or relay. Cracked lenses allow moisture inside, which will short out the bulb or corrode the socket. Sometimes the problem is just a loose ground wire that needs to be tightened.
Lighting Maintenance
- Monthly walk-arounds are the best way to catch a dead bulb before the police do.
- Replacing in pairs ensures that both sides have the same brightness and color.
- Cleaning lenses with a restoration kit can make your old headlights look and work like new.
- Checking fuses if an entire set of lights (like all the dash lights) goes out at once.
Power Windows and Door Lock Issues

It is very annoying when your window gets stuck halfway down in a rainstorm. Power locks and windows rely on small motors hidden inside your doors. These parts work hard and eventually wear out from years of use. Keeping them clean can help them last much longer.
Common Failure Points
- Windows stuck either up or down are usually a sign of a dead regulator motor.
- Grinding sounds inside the door mean the cables or gears for the window are broken.
- Unresponsive locks can be caused by a bad actuator or a dying key fob battery.
- Slow movement of the glass suggests the motor is weak or the tracks are dirty.
Root Causes
The window regulator motor simply wears out after thousands of cycles. Lock actuators can fail if they get wet or if the internal gears break. Wiring in the door hinges is a major fail point because it bends every time you open the door. Dirt and gunk in the window tracks put a lot of extra stress on the motor.
Prevention Tips
- Cleaning tracks with a little silicone spray reduces friction and helps the motor breathe easy.
- Fob batteries should be changed every year or two to keep your locks working perfectly.
- Avoiding the switch after the window is closed prevents you from burning out the motor.
- Winter care involves making sure the windows are not frozen shut before you try to roll them down.
Instrument Cluster and Dashboard Glitches

Your dashboard is the primary way your car communicates with you. If the gauges stop working, you won’t know your speed or how much gas you have. These car electrical problems can be very frustrating to deal with. Often, they are caused by a lack of steady power to the dash.
Signs of Electronic Failure
- Freezing gauges might get stuck at a certain speed even after you stop.
- Erratic sweeping of the needles can happen when the cluster loses its ground connection.
- Warning lights popping up randomly often point to a computer or voltage problem.
- Dark dashboard means the backlighting has failed or a fuse has blown.
Causes and Professional Repair
Loose wiring harnesses behind the dash can cause the cluster to lose power intermittently. Sometimes the internal control board develops tiny cracks in the solder joints. Voltage drops from a weak battery can cause the electronics to act very strange. A professional shop can often test and repair the cluster without replacing it.
Longevity Strategies
- Windshield seals must be kept in good shape to prevent water from leaking onto the dash.
- Software updates from the dealer can often fix known bugs in the instrument cluster.
- Steady voltage from a healthy battery and alternator is the best medicine for car electronics.
- Prompt attention to small flickers can prevent the whole cluster from dying on you.

FAQs
What does a parasitic battery drain mean?
This occurs when an electrical component continues to draw power from the battery even after the engine is turned off and the key is removed. Common culprits include glove box lights that stay on, malfunctioning alarms, or stuck relays.
Can a blown head gasket cause electrical issues?
While a head gasket is mechanical, a failure can cause coolant to leak onto sensitive electrical connectors or sensors. This moisture creates short circuits and can lead to false readings or total sensor failure.
How do I jump-start a car with a hybrid battery system?
Most hybrids have a standard 12V battery in addition to the high-voltage pack. You must locate the specific jump-start terminals, often under the hood in a fuse box, rather than connecting directly to the high-voltage battery.
Why does my radio reset every time I start the engine?
This usually indicates a constant power wire (memory wire) has a loose connection or a blown fuse. It can also happen if your battery voltage drops too low during cranking, causing the radio to lose its temporary memory.
Can aftermarket LED bulbs cause dashboard error lights?
Yes, because LEDs draw much less power than halogen bulbs, the car’s computer may think the bulb is blown. Installing load resistors or “CAN Bus” compatible bulbs is usually required to fix this “hyper-flash” or warning light.
What is a ground strap and why is it important?
A ground strap is a heavy cable connecting the engine or battery to the car’s frame. If it is loose or corroded, electrical current cannot return to the battery, causing flickering lights and erratic engine behavior.
Does a bad ignition switch cause electrical accessories to fail?
The ignition switch sends power to different circuits like the “Accessory” or “Run” positions. If the internal contacts wear out, your radio or wipers might stop working even if the car is running perfectly.
Why is there a clicking noise coming from under my dashboard?
This is often a failing relay or a malfunctioning HVAC actuator motor. Relays click when they don’t have enough voltage to stay closed or when they are internally shorting out.
Can a car battery freeze?
A fully charged battery will not freeze until it reaches extremely low temperatures, but a discharged battery has more water than acid. This can cause the casing to crack and the internal plates to warp in freezing weather.
What happens if I connect jumper cables backward?
Reversing the polarity can instantly fry the alternator’s diodes, blow expensive “main” fuses, and potentially destroy the vehicle’s Engine Control Unit (ECU).
Why do my power locks cycle on and off while I am driving?
This is often caused by a faulty door pin switch or a “ghost” signal from a damaged keyless entry module. The car incorrectly thinks a door is being opened or closed and attempts to secure the vehicle.
Is it safe to wash my engine bay with a pressure washer?
High-pressure water can force moisture into sealed electrical connectors, sensors, and the alternator. If you must wash it, cover electrical components with plastic and use low pressure.
How does road salt affect vehicle wiring?
Salt acts as an electrolyte that accelerates corrosion. It can eat through wire insulation and cause “green crust” on connectors, which increases electrical resistance and heat.
Can a failing fuel pump cause an electrical short?
As a fuel pump motor wears out, it may begin to draw significantly more amperage than usual. This can melt the fuel pump relay or blow the fuse repeatedly before the pump actually stops working.
Why does my car horn sound weak or muffled?
This could be a sign of low voltage reaching the horn or corrosion on the horn’s mounting bolt, which serves as its electrical ground.
What is a “CAN Bus” system?
The Controller Area Network (CAN Bus) is a communication standard that allows vehicle microcontrollers to talk to each other without a complex web of individual wires. A single short in this system can disable multiple unrelated features.
Can a bad battery cause transmission shifting problems?
Modern automatic transmissions use electronic solenoids to change gears. If the battery or alternator provides inconsistent voltage, the transmission computer may struggle to trigger these solenoids, leading to harsh shifts.
Why do my headlights get brighter when I rev the engine?
This usually indicates a failing voltage regulator inside the alternator. It is failing to cap the voltage, which can eventually blow bulbs and damage sensitive electronics.
Can a dash cam drain my car battery?
If a dash cam is hardwired to a “constant” power source rather than a “switched” one, it will continue to record and draw power until the battery is too weak to start the car.
What is the difference between a fuse and a circuit breaker in a car?
A fuse melts and must be replaced once it fails. Some modern vehicles or aftermarket systems use circuit breakers that can be reset manually or automatically once the overload is removed.
